Silverthorne Real Estate Market Overview

Silverthorne’s condo market attracts buyers looking for flexibility, central access, and a broader range of ownership options.

Current Market Snapshot
• Typical price range for condos: approximately $300K–$1.3M+
• Premium pricing for updated interiors, strong views, and newer or well-managed communities

Strong demand from:
• Second-home buyers
• Full-time residents
• Buyers seeking a more approachable entry point into Summit County

Neighborhoods like Wildernest remain especially relevant because they often offer a more affordable price point than some neighboring towns. That said, HOA fees can be a major factor in the overall ownership picture, and buyers should weigh monthly dues carefully when comparing value.

For buyers looking for newer, lock-and-leave condo living, communities such as River West, Blue River Flats, and 4th Street Crossing stand out. Located along the Blue River, these newer developments appeal to buyers who want a more modern feel, convenient access to town, and a property that is often well suited for rental use.

Buying a Condo in Silverthorne: What Buyers Should Know

Neighborhood Highlights

Silverthorne condo buyers are often drawn to settings that feel connected to both the outdoors and the town’s growing energy.

Wildernest remains one of the best-known condo areas because it offers a more affordable entry point, a strong local feel, and quick access to hiking and outdoor recreation. Many properties sit in elevated settings with beautiful mountain views, and some capture the kind of wide-open vistas that make owners feel tucked into the landscape.

For buyers looking for newer condo communities, River West, Blue River Flats, and 4th Street Crossing stand out for their more modern style, Blue River setting, and easy, lock- and-leave convenience.

What continues to make Silverthorne stand out is the lifestyle woven around it—time at the Silverthorne Pavilion, gathering with friends at Bluebird Market, stopping into Angry James Brewery, enjoying plays and performances through Silverthorne Performing Arts, exploring the creativity of Art Spot, where artists rent space to create and work, or spending an afternoon fly fishing on the Blue River.

Together, these places give Silverthorne a lively but still approachable feel, blending mountain living with a growing sense of culture, creativity, community, and ease.
